    What’s better than two inclusive festivals in one half term? Errrm… THREE, that’s what!

    On Tuesday 10th February, it was the turn of Rabbits Class, who travelled to The Dolphin Leisure Centre in Haywards Heath to take part in the annual Boccia and NAK Festival.

    The event was fantastic, with nine stations for our students to access. Six were variations of these traditional sports, while the remaining three focused on fun, fundamental skill activities, including bean bag target throwing. Everyone   thoroughly enjoyed the event, and we were incredibly impressed by how well the students adapted to the different challenges, followed instructions safely, and participated with growing confidence.

    The fun didn’t stop early either—everyone stayed for the full duration of the event, which says it all!  A massive congratulations to Rabbits Class. We are so proud of you—well done, Rabbits!

    On Wednesday 4th February, Robin’s Class represented Woodlands Meed for the very first time, making their debut at the annual NAK Festival hosted by Imberhorne Upper School.

    This was a massive achievement for the students, as they were required to adapt to a different setting, with different people, while taking part in a new activity. Well done, guys, we are very proud of you!  We would also like to say a special thank you to the staff, and especially the Sports’ Leaders at Imberhorne, who were absolutely brilliant with our children.

    The children were an absolute credit to the school, showing fantastic adaptability as they took part in less familiar activities, competed alongside new peers, and navigated an unfamiliar setting with confidence. Each student approached the morning in their own unique way, bringing enthusiasm, positivity, and plenty of fun to the session. We are incredibly proud of you all!
